Last Updated at 11 October 2024SEPSNGITHIANG CNI LPS: A Comprehensive Profile of a Rural Primary School in Meghalaya
Nestled in the rural landscape of Mawthadraishan block, West Khasi Hills district, Meghalaya, lies SEPSNGITHIANG CNI LPS, a primary school with a rich history dating back to 1947. This privately aided co-educational institution plays a vital role in providing education to the local community. With a focus on providing quality primary education, the school serves students from Class 1 to Class 4.
The school's infrastructure comprises three well-maintained classrooms dedicated to instruction. Two boys' toilets and two girls' toilets cater to the students' sanitation needs. The school utilizes tap water as its primary source of drinking water, ensuring access to clean and safe hydration. The school's management emphasizes the importance of providing a nutritious mid-day meal prepared and served on the school premises. Khasi serves as the primary language of instruction, fostering a connection to the local culture and language.
The teaching staff consists of a dedicated team of three teachers, including one male and two female educators. The school is headed by Tophas L. Nonglait, who provides strong leadership and guidance to the faculty. The school operates as a non-residential institution, reflecting its commitment to providing a safe and secure learning environment for the children.
The school's academic focus is exclusively primary education, catering to students from Class 1 to Class 4. The institution follows a curriculum designed to meet the educational needs of its students. Although the school is not equipped with computers or a computer-aided learning lab, the dedicated teachers strive to provide a comprehensive education. The absence of a school library also points to a need for additional resources to further enhance the learning experience.
The school's building is privately owned, and despite not having a boundary wall or electricity connection, it functions effectively to provide essential primary education. This lack of infrastructure highlights the challenges faced by rural schools in accessing basic amenities. The absence of a playground further emphasizes the limitations on extracurricular activities and recreational opportunities for students. The school is accessible via an all-weather road, ensuring year-round accessibility for students and staff.
The school's academic year commences in April, aligning with the regional academic calendar.
